POD#1 s/p VSG
surgery was at 10:30. all i remember was being wheeled in. saw the anesthesiologist give me IV medications. and then i remember waking up in recovery. i asked for pain meds immediately and passed out every 5-10 mins in my room. i had some reflux and nausea, and i received iv zofran and a ppi. it helped. you get iv tylenol here. which is super nice. back in the states, iv tylenol is expensive as f and reserved for orthopedic patients in some hospitals. the nursing staff is super nice. it helps speaking spanish to relay my issues.
so today; pod#1 goals. keep walking. stop hiccuping and use my incentive spirometer to prevent atelectasis. plus shower. and remove this drain.
